Samurai Ressurected!
Bobby Thao | Fresno, CA | 01/13/2006
(3 out of 5 stars)

"THE GOOD: The movie had good casting, great scenary, and a great display of fighting. The fighting were authentic moves and the characters looked realistic. Some people might rate this movie bad, because they don't understand Japanese films. The story was good and if you understand Japanese films and culture, this movie will set in for you quite well. The movie would of been great, but some things had to bring it down.

THE BAD: The movie was pretty short. It could of been pushed a little longer. The ending wasn't conclusive enough and you will want more when you see the ending. The story of Jubei Yagyu's adventure is pretty detailed and the movie didn't give it enough time to explain it all. The fight scenes could of been much longer too and I don't see why they cut so much of the fight scenes when that was the most important parts of the movie. They tried to squeeze out too much in too little time. The lack of more blood also made the movie sink down. In Samurai movies, the blood is essential and fans of Jubei seeing blood squirting from a chopped off head is what they want to see.

OVERALL: The movie was a good showing with flaws. It had all the elements, but it didn't live up to the hype. Still, it is a good movie to at least watch once or twice. And for fans, it is a good one."
